Migration strategies involve multiple tiers:
Rehosting (Lift and Shift)
Refactoring (Optimizing for cloud features)
Replacing (Switching to SaaS models)
Replatforming (Updating underlying operating systems)

The Hybrid Model Reality
In-house servers are not entirely obsolete
Specific workloads remain on-premise for performance
Latency-sensitive applications (CAD, high-resolution video editing)
Local storage for large datasets without recurring egress fees
Hybrid cloud infrastructure combines both environments
Secure tunnels (VPN/SD-WAN) connect local and cloud resources

Synchronization of active directories
Unified user credentials
Redundant backup paths
On-site storage used as a fast-cache for cloud files
Operational Control:
Direct access to physical hardware
Compliance requirements for data residency
Predictable costs for stable workloads
Local network speed (10Gbps+ LAN) vs. Internet speed

Cost Analysis: Cloud vs. On-Premise
On-Premise Expenses:
Server hardware ($5,000 – $20,000+)
Server licensing (Windows Server, SQL)
Professional installation labor
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S) units
Replacement parts (Hard drives, power supplies)
Cooling and electricity
Cloud Expenses:
Monthly subscription fees
Data egress charges
Storage tiering costs
Managed IT service fees
Premium support options
Economic Evaluation:
OpEx allows for predictable monthly budgeting
Elimination of "surprise" hardware failure costs
Scale-up or scale-down capability based on staff count
Tax benefits of service-based models

Technical Implementation Details
Migration phases are strictly followed
Discovery phase identifies all dependencies
Pilot phase tests critical applications
Production migration occurs during low-impact hours
Post-migration support resolves user access issues
Active Directory Synchronization:
Azure AD Connect (Entra ID) configuration
Single Sign-On (SSO) for third-party apps
Password hash synchronization
Security group mapping
Network Optimization:
Router configurations for cloud traffic
DNS record updates (MX, SPF, DKIM)
Latency testing for remote desktops (RDP/AVD)
